Staffing Ratio Comparison
How The Cathedral School of St Anne and St James's student-to-teacher ratio compares to state and national averages. A lower ratio generally means more individual attention per student.
13.1:1
12.2:1
12.3:1
With a ratio of 13.1:1, this school's ratio is higher than the QLD average (12.2:1) and the national average (12.3:1).
